Thiart R, Scholtz CL, Vergotine J, Hoogendijk CF, de Villiers JN, Nissen H, Brusgaard K, Gaffney D, Hoffs MS, Vermaak WJ, Kotze MJ. Predominance of a 6 bp deletion in exon 2 of the LDL receptor gene in Africans with familial hypercholesterolaemia. J Med Genet 2000; 37:514-9. [PMID: 10882754 PMCID: PMC1734636 DOI: 10.1136/jmg.37.7.514] [Citation(s) in RCA: 11]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/03/2022]
Abstract
In South Africa, the high prevalence of familial hypercholesterolaemia (FH) among Afrikaners, Jews, and Indians as a result of founder genes is in striking contrast to its reported virtual absence in the black population in general. In this study, the molecular basis of primary hypercholesterolaemia was studied in 16 Africans diagnosed with FH. DNA analysis using three screening methods resulted in the identification of seven different mutations in the coding region of the low density lipoprotein (LDLR) gene in 10 of the patients analysed. These included a 6 bp deletion (GCGATG) accounting for 28% of defective alleles, and six point mutations (D151H, R232W, R385Q, E387K, P678L, and R793Q) detected in single families. The Sotho patient with missense mutation R232W was also heterozygous for a de novo splicing defect 313+1G-->A. Several silent mutations/polymorphisms were detected in the LDLR and apolipoprotein B genes, including a base change (g-->t) at nucleotide position -175 in the FP2 LDLR regulatory element. This promoter variant was detected at a significantly higher (p<0.05) frequency in FH patients compared to controls and occurred in cis with mutation E387K in one family. Analysis of four intragenic LDLR gene polymorphisms showed that the same chromosomal background was identified at this locus in the four FH patients with the 6 bp deletion. Detection of the 6 bp deletion in Xhosa, Pedi, and Tswana FH patients suggests that it is an ancient mutation predating tribal separation approximately 3000 years ago.

Pullinger CR, Gaffney D, Gutierrez MM, Malloy MJ, Schumaker VN, Packard CJ, Kane JP. The apolipoprotein B R3531C mutation. Characteristics of 24 subjects from 9 kindreds. J Lipid Res 1999; 40:318-27. [PMID: 9925662]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/10/2023] Open
Abstract
Familial ligand-defective apolipoprotein B (apoB) is a group of disorders caused by mutations in the apoB gene. In this report the R3531C mutation is characterized further using a monoclonal antibody MB19/dynamic laser light scattering technique to measure ratios of Cys(3531) to normal low density lipoprotein (LDL) particles. All six subjects studied showed a preferential accumulation of particles carrying the defective apoB allotype. We determined binding properties of LDL from R3531C heterozygotes by measurement of high-affinity binding to LDL receptors on fibroblasts and its ability promote growth of U937 cells. LDL from R3531C heterozygotes, compared to normal LDL, had 49.3% of the binding affinity and was 74% as effective in a U937 cell proliferation assay. To identify new probands, we screened 2570 subjects for the R3531C mutation. Nine probands were found with 15 affected relatives. Of the seven haplotypes we uncovered, two were novel, while five were identical to one initially reported as associated with Cys3531. Three silent mutations were detected also: T3540T, N3542N and T3552T. Analysis of lipid profiles of R3531C families showed, as with the R3500Q mutation, variable expression of the phenotype, modulated by environmental and other genetic factors. Both mutations tend to produce lower plasma levels of LDL in affected subjects than do defects of the LDL receptor (familial hypercholesterolemia, FH). This study shows that the Cys(3531) LDL particles are not only defective at binding to the LDL receptor, as determined by two separate methods, but that in all cases they accumulate preferentially compared to the normal allotype.-Pullinger, C. McFarlane D, Sellon DC, Gaffney D, Hedgpeth V, Papich M, Gibbs S. Hematologic and serum biochemical variables and plasma corticotropin concentration in healthy aged horses. Am J Vet Res 1998; 59:1247-51. [PMID: 9781456]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/09/2023]
Abstract
OBJECTIVES To compare hematologic and serum biochemical variables and plasma ACTH concentration between healthy horses 5 to 12 years old and those more than 20 years old. ANIMALS 30 healthy horses 5 to 12 years old and 30 healthy horses more than 20 years old. PROCEDURES Venous blood was collected from all horses, and CBC and serum biochemical analysis were performed for each horse. Plasma ACTH concentration was determined by radioimmunoassay. Student's paired t-test or the Mann-Whitney rank sum test was used to compare values between control and aged horse groups. RESULTS Compared with values for control horses, aged horses had significantly higher erythrocyte mean cell volume and mean cell hemoglobin. Aged horses also had significantly decreased total lymphocyte count. Five aged horses had lymphocyte count that was lower than the low reference limit as established for horses in our laboratory. Differences between control and aged horses for serum biochemical or plasma ACTH values were not significant. CONCLUSION Compared with younger adult horses, those more than 20 years old have some hematologic differences, but there is no apparent effect of aging on baseline plasma ACTH concentration. CLINICAL RELEVANCE It is important to establish age-matched control values for optimal interpretation of clinicopathologic variables.

Warshaw DM, Hayes E, Gaffney D, Lauzon AM, Wu J, Kennedy G, Trybus K, Lowey S, Berger C. Myosin conformational states determined by single fluorophore polarization. Proc Natl Acad Sci U S A 1998; 95:8034-9. [PMID: 9653135 PMCID: PMC20924 DOI: 10.1073/pnas.95.14.8034] [Citation(s) in RCA: 97] [Impact Index Per Article: 3.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/08/2023] Open
Abstract
Muscle contraction is powered by the interaction of the molecular motor myosin with actin. With new techniques for single molecule manipulation and fluorescence detection, it is now possible to correlate, within the same molecule and in real time, conformational states and mechanical function of myosin. A spot-confocal microscope, capable of detecting single fluorophore polarization, was developed to measure orientational states in the smooth muscle myosin light chain domain during the process of motion generation. Fluorescently labeled turkey gizzard smooth muscle myosin was prepared by removal of endogenous regulatory light chain and re-addition of the light chain labeled at cysteine-108 with the 6-isomer of iodoacetamidotetramethylrhodamine (6-IATR). Single myosin molecule fluorescence polarization data, obtained in a motility assay, provide direct evidence that the myosin light chain domain adopts at least two orientational states during the cyclic interaction of myosin with actin, a randomly disordered state, most likely associated with myosin whereas weakly bound to actin, and an ordered state in which the light chain domain adopts a finite angular orientation whereas strongly bound after the powerstroke.

Lee WK, Haddad L, Macleod MJ, Dorrance AM, Wilson DJ, Gaffney D, Dominiczak MH, Packard CJ, Day IN, Humphries SE, Dominiczak AF. Identification of a common low density lipoprotein receptor mutation (C163Y) in the west of Scotland. J Med Genet 1998; 35:573-8. [PMID: 9678702 PMCID: PMC1051368 DOI: 10.1136/jmg.35.7.573] [Citation(s) in RCA: 13]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/30/2023]
Abstract
Familial hypercholesterolaemia (FH) is an autosomal codominant disorder characterised by high levels of LDL cholesterol and a high incidence of coronary artery disease. Our aims were to track the low density lipoprotein receptor (LDLR) gene in individual families with phenotypic FH and to identify and characterise any mutations of the LDLR gene that may be common in the west of Scotland FH population using single strand conformational polymorphism analysis (SSCP). Patient samples consisted of 80 heterozygous probands with FH, 200 subjects who were related to the probands, and a further 50 normal, unrelated control subjects. Tracking of the LDLR gene was accomplished by amplification of a 19 allele tetranucleotide microsatellite that is tightly linked to the LDLR gene locus. Primers specific for exon 4 of the LDLR gene were used to amplify genomic DNA and used for SSCP analysis. Any PCR products with different migration patterns as assessed by SSCP were then sequenced directly. In addition to identifying probands with a common mutation, family members were screened using a forced restriction site assay and analysed using microplate array diagonal gel electrophoresis (MADGE). Microsatellite D19S394 analysis was informative in 20 of 23 families studied. In these families there was no inconsistency with segregation of the FH phenotype with the LDLR locus. Of the FH probands, 15/80 had a mutant allele as assessed by SSCP using three pairs of primers covering the whole of exon 4 of the LDLR gene. Direct DNA sequencing showed that 7/15 of the probands had a C163Y mutation. Using a PCR induced restriction site assay for the enzyme RsaI and MADGE, it was determined that the C163Y mutation cosegregated with the FH phenotype in family members of the FH probands. This mutant allele was not present in any of the control subjects. Microsatellite analysis has proven useful in tracking the LDLR gene and could be used in conjunction with LDL cholesterol levels to diagnose FH, especially in children and young adults where phenotypic diagnosis can be difficult.

Gaffney D, Hoffs MS, Cameron IM, Stewart G, O'Reilly DS, Packard CJ. Influence of polymorphism Q3405E and mutation A3371V in the apolipoprotein B gene on LDL receptor binding. Atherosclerosis 1998; 137:167-74. [PMID: 9568749 DOI: 10.1016/s0021-9150(97)00242-6]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/07/2023]
Abstract
Familial defective apolipoprotein B (FDB) is due to mutations in the apolipoprotein B (apo B) gene at codon 3500 or 3531 that affect low density lipoprotein (LDL) receptor binding. From sequence analysis the putative receptor binding site was believed originally to be upstream from this at residues 3147-3157 and 3357-3367. Using denaturing gradient gel electrophoresis, mutations were sought in codons 3350-3466. This includes the important positively charged residues 3357-3367. DNA from 928 hyperlipidaemic individuals was studied and two hitherto unknown DNA changes were discovered, one of which resulted in an altered amino acid in the apo B. A known polymorphism Q3405E was also detected at a carrier frequency of 1.4%. Using growth of U937 cells as a measure of binding affinity of LDL to its receptor the newly discovered mutant A3371V permitted the same growth as LDL from normolipidaemic individuals of the U937 cells, however, the LDL from Q3405E individuals permitted only 77% of the normal growth (P=0.009).

Pollock A, Gaffney D, Dunnigan M, Shaoul J. Acute services. Time to strip the beds? THE HEALTH SERVICE JOURNAL 1997; 107:30-3. [PMID: 10175617]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 02/11/2023]
Abstract
The health authority and trust proposals for Birmingham's health services, currently the subject of consultation, are radical, untested and uncosted. They assume that once emergency assessment and ambulatory care centres are operational, under half the current caseload will need inpatient stays. University Hospital Birmingham trust's proposal for a new hospital built and operated by the private sector assumes no growth in activity and a 17 per cent reduction in the present bed complement, at a time when emergency admissions in Birmingham are increasing by 5 per cent a year. Analysis of the proposals suggests they will destabilise an already precarious acute service in Birmingham.

Gaffney D, Reid JM, Cameron IM, Vass K, Caslake MJ, Shepherd J, Packard CJ. Independent mutations at codon 3500 of the apolipoprotein B gene are associated with hyperlipidemia. Arterioscler Thromb Vasc Biol 1995; 15:1025-9. [PMID: 7627691 DOI: 10.1161/01.atv.15.8.1025] [Citation(s) in RCA: 102] [Impact Index Per Article: 3.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/26/2023]
Abstract
The apoB arginine-to glutamine change at codon 3500 has become established as a cause of failure of binding of the LDL particle to its receptor and the consequent hypercholesterolemia of familial defective apoB 100. A search for further similar mutations was undertaken by systematic screening of a candidate region of the apoB gene from individuals with hypercholesterolemia. Polymerase chain reaction and denaturing gradient gel electrophoresis were used. We describe two families in which a different mutation in the codon 3500 causes an arginine-to-tryptophan substitution. Most adults in these families who have this mutation have hypercholesterolemia. LDL derived from all who have inherited the mutation is dysfunctional in that it allows only poor growth of an LDL cholesterol-dependent cell line. We conclude that this arginine 3500 is essential to the function of apoB and that its loss and replacement by glutamine or tryptophan is responsible for the hypercholesterolemia of familial defective apoB 100.

Lyon TD, Fell GS, Gaffney D, McGaw BA, Russell RI, Park RH, Beattie AD, Curry G, Crofton RJ, Gunn I. Use of a stable copper isotope (65Cu) in the differential diagnosis of Wilson's disease. Clin Sci (Lond) 1995; 88:727-32. [PMID: 7634759 DOI: 10.1042/cs0880727] [Citation(s) in RCA: 32] [Impact Index Per Article: 1.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/26/2023]
Abstract
1. 65Cu/63Cu stable-isotope ratios have been measured in blood serum after oral administration of the stable isotope 65Cu. The incorporation of the isotope into the plasma protein pool was followed at various times for up to 3 days. The resulting patterns of enrichment in healthy control subjects, in Wilson's disease patients and in heterozygotes for the Wilson's disease gene, were similar in appearance to those found by others using copper radioactive isotopes. After an initially high enrichment at 2 h after dosage, the Wilson's disease cases, in contrast to the control subjects, did not show a secondary rise in isotope enrichment of the plasma pool after 72 h, demonstrating a failure to incorporate copper into caeruloplasmin. The Wilson's disease heterozygotes had variable degrees of impairment of isotope incorporation, not always distinguished from those of control subjects. 2. The stability of the isotope also permits the copper tracer to be followed for a longer period. Ten healthy subjects were studied for over 40 days, allowing the biological half-time of an oral dose of copper to be determined (median 18.5 days, 95% confidence interval 14-26 days). Known heterozygotes for the Wilson's disease gene were found to have a significantly increased biological half-time for removal of copper from the plasma pool (median 43 days, 95% confidence interval 32-77 days). 3. The incorporation of 65 Cu in patients with diseases of the liver (other than Wilson's disease) was found to be similar to that in control subjects, aiding differential diagnosis.

Dorak MT, Mills KI, Gaffney D, Wilson DW, Galbraith I, Henderson N, Burnett AK. Homozygous MHC genotypes and longevity. Hum Hered 1994; 44:271-8. [PMID: 7927356 DOI: 10.1159/000154229] [Citation(s) in RCA: 12]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/27/2023] Open
Abstract
To investigate the relevance of the major histocompatibility complex (MHC) in longevity, we carried out a molecular analysis of the MHC in 432 unrelated healthy individuals. The comparison of individuals < or = 25 years and > 25 years showed that the 5.8-kb DQA1 allele, which corresponds to HLA-DR53, was negatively associated with longevity (p = 0.0035) resulting mainly from decreased homozygosity with age for that allele (p = 0.008), and restricted to males (p = 0.008). The difference was more striking for the 5.8 kb DQA1: 9.0 kb HSP70 haplotype again only in males (26.3 vs. 6.2%; p = 0.017, OR = 5.4, 95% CI = 1.5 - 19.5). The oldest male subject homozygous for this DQA1: HSP70 haplotype was 54 years (p = 0.005). Comparing leukemic patients and healthy individuals with the same ethnic and geographical origin, homozygosity for these genotypes was more frequent in the young leukemic group. The results suggested the existence of recessive deleterious genes in a segment of HLA-DR53 haplotypes.

Freeman DJ, Griffin BA, Holmes AP, Lindsay GM, Gaffney D, Packard CJ, Shepherd J. Regulation of plasma HDL cholesterol and subfraction distribution by genetic and environmental factors. Associations between the TaqI B RFLP in the CETP gene and smoking and obesity. ARTERIOSCLEROSIS AND THROMBOSIS : A JOURNAL OF VASCULAR BIOLOGY 1994; 14:336-44. [PMID: 7907227 DOI: 10.1161/01.atv.14.3.336] [Citation(s) in RCA: 125] [Impact Index Per Article: 4.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/27/2023]
Abstract
This study investigated in a healthy population (n = 220) the association of the TaqI B restriction fragment length polymorphism (RFLP) in the cholesteryl ester transfer protein (CETP) gene with plasma high-density lipoprotein (HDL) cholesterol concentration and subfraction distribution. A raised HDL cholesterol level was found in B2B2 homozygotes (B2 cutting site absent) and was associated specifically with a 45% increase in HDL2 compared with B1B1 homozygotes (B1B1, 77 +/- 39 mg/100 mL, mean +/- SD; B2B2, 112 +/- 59 mg/100 mL; P < 0.01). Total plasma, very-low-density lipoprotein, and HDL triglyceride levels did not differ among the genotype groups, nor did plasma apolipoprotein AI levels (B1B1, 1.45 +/- 0.35 mg/mL, mean +/- SD; B2B2, 1.56 +/- 0.33 mg/mL). Thus, the genetic variation appeared to be independent of metabolic factors that are known to regulate HDL levels. Plasma CETP exchange activity was unlikely to be the cause of the association, since it did not differ between genotype groups and was not correlated with HDL2 concentration. Multivariate analysis demonstrated that the TaqI B polymorphism had an effect on HDL cholesterol and HDL2 that was independent of age, sex, body mass index, oral contraceptive use, exercise, alcohol consumption, and plasma triglycerides. In smokers, the presence of the B2B2 genotype did not result in increased HDL cholesterol or HDL2, whereas in obese subjects, the difference between B1B1 and B2B2 individuals was diminished. We conclude that the TaqI B RFLP is associated with a quantitatively significant effect on plasma HDL2 levels that is independent of plasma triglycerides and interacts with lifestyle factors.

Carey V, Chapman S, Gaffney D. Children's lives or garden aesthetics? A case study in public health advocacy. AUSTRALIAN JOURNAL OF PUBLIC HEALTH 1994; 18:25-32. [PMID: 8068788 DOI: 10.1111/j.1753-6405.1994.tb00190.x] [Citation(s) in RCA: 79] [Impact Index Per Article: 2.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/28/2023]
Abstract
Following a decade of accumulating clinical reports on child drowning in domestic swimming pools, paediatricians began advocating legislation that would require all pools to be 'isolation' fenced. In 1990, the New South Wales Government introduced and then repeated such legislation following intense lobbying and media advocacy from a group of pool owners. This paper reviews the ways in which isolation fence advocates and opponents framed their public arguments. Five main areas of competing public discourse are identified: why pool drownings occur; the effects of fencing; expert views and community support; the role of the state in prevention; and personalised references to the value systems of those involved in the debate. Two factors seem likely to have contributed most to the overthrow of the legislation: fence opponents inhabiting the same noninterventionist ideological frame of reference as the government; and fence advocates' refusal to compromise on retrospective fencing seems likely to have inspired a commitment in opposition which would have been absent if an incrementalist, prospective fencing policy had been adopted.
